Holy Cross Health in partnership with ArtServe, an award-winning non-profit arts incubator, presents Inspiring Women, an exhibition dedicated to the inspiration and empowerment of women in the arts.

The “Inspiring Women” Exhibition showcases the fine art works of members of the National League of American Pen Women (Pen Women), Fort Lauderdale Branch, a community of professional award-winning, internationally recognized and collected women visual artists. Pen Women believe in the power of art to illuminate the human experience, fire the imagination and nurture the soul. Through a variety of media, including acrylic, watercolor, oil, sculptor and photography, artists’ heartfelt works reflect subjects and causes that inspire them with the intent to inspire others, in particular women. The oldest women’s art organization in America, NLAPW was originally founded in 1897 by Marian Longfellow Donoghue (niece of Henry Wadsworth Longfellow), to empower professional women journalists who were discriminated against and excluded by major publications.
